码迷,mamicode.com
首页 > 微信 > 详细

微信域名防封跳转技术原理,微信域名防封的细节把控

时间:2019-03-01 14:14:29      阅读:597      评论:0      收藏:0      [点我收藏+]

标签:切换   img   size   api   错误页面   安防   直接   源码解析   int   

微信域名检测技术的主要用户是微信域名防封,大家知道拼多多这种网站,靠诱导分享方式在微信里面摇身一变已经估值160亿美元,身价仅次于京东了 ,这是何等的速度,简直是惊为天人,But如果你想使用微信病毒营销,腾讯不封死你才怪,早期微信抓分享不严格,现在很严,拼多多是腾讯干儿子自然不封,任你举报到死他也依然不死。那我们怎么在微信内正确地使用分享和推广呢,怎么让推广效率成倍提升呢?那就是防止域名被微信封掉,其中有一个必备的技术是微信域名防封技术。

源码解析

$url = "http://api.monkeyapi.com";
$params = array(
‘appkey‘ =>‘appkey‘,//您申请的APPKEY
‘url‘ =>‘www.monkeyapi.com‘,//需要查询的网站
);

$paramstring = http_build_query($params);
$content = monkeyCurl($url, $paramstring);
$result = json_decode($content, true);
if($result) {
    var_dump($result);
}else {
    //请求异常
}<<--有不懂的加q咨询:511979480-->>
/**
    * 请求接口返回内容
    * @param    string $url [请求的URL地址]
    * @param    string $params [请求的参数]
    * @param    int $ipost [是否采用POST形式]
    * @return    string
*/
function monkeyCurl($url, $params = false, $ispost = 0)
{
    $httpInfo = array();
    $ch = curl_init();

    curl_setopt($ch, CURLOPT_HTTP_VERSION, CURL_HTTP_VERSION_1_1);
    curl_setopt($ch, CURLOPT_CONNECTTIMEOUT, 60);
    curl_setopt($ch, CURLOPT_TIMEOUT, 60);
    cur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
    curl_setopt($ch, CURLOPT_FOLLOWLOCATION, true);
    if ($ispost) {
        curl_setopt($ch, CURLOPT_POST, true);
        curl_setopt($ch, CURLOPT_POSTFIELDS, $params);
        curl_setopt($ch, CURLOPT_URL, $url);
    }else {
        if ($params) {
            curl_setopt($ch, CURLOPT_URL, $url.‘?‘.$params);
        } else {
            curl_setopt($ch, CURLOPT_URL, $url);
        }
    }

    $response = curl_exec($ch);
        if ($response === FALSE) {
        //echo "cURL Error: " . curl_error($ch);
        return false;
    }

    $httpCode = curl_getinfo($ch, CURLINFO_HTTP_CODE);
    $httpInfo = array_merge($httpInfo, curl_getinfo($ch));
    curl_close($ch);
    return $response;
}

技术图片

微信监控对象

腾讯重点监控对象:微商,金融,赌博,色流,直销,灰色项目等。因为微信属性社交,不可能不监控监管这些交易及广告行为,所以微信之危可想而知,故成众矢之的。微信会重点打击非法营销活动的人售假诈骗等。导致被封的根本原因如下:
1、被人举报,之前被封过的微信(群发,朋友圈广告)。
2、朋友圈80%以上相似(应对群控系统)。
3、频繁切换微信帐号,频繁转帐都是有风险(双开,多开)。
4、滥用营销软件,加人软件,虚拟定位软件,抢红包软件(滥用软件)。

域名被封的原因

1. 域名来源,在微信有过黑历史,被人使用过在微信有过不良记录,后来被人为各种方法恢复后转到你手上,这种域名很容易被封。

2. 域名分享转发量太大。

3. 域名指向的站点内容违规,站点内容被微信记录html结构特征。

4. 微信对内容违规的站点URL记录结构特征。

5. 同行竞争,恶意举报。

6. 服务器ip被加入封杀黑名单。

 

防封解决方案

1. 老站和知名站点的域名

其实是跳板原理。建站时间久和行业内相对知名的域名最不容易被微信封杀,当跳转代码注入到上述网站再利用安防等我网址做跳转,指向落地页,被微信封杀的可能性微乎其微;也有同行用融合软件解决,这个问题我可以和大家单独讨论。

2. 微信域名检测接口

微信域名检测接口,做到防患于未然。这个可以自己开发也可以购买。

3. 随机访问落地页

把A域名,作为分享域名; 把B域名,作为落地域名(也就是用户访问看到的域名); 只有从A域名跳转到B域名,B域名显示的才是我们想展示给用户的内容,如果直接复制B的网址,打开的只是一个错误页面或者不违规的内容,也就是说如果TA点击右上角举报,举报的和访问的虽然是同一个网址,可是显示的内容却不同。从而最大限度的防止域名被封杀。

4. 屏蔽微信右上角举报按钮

通过技术,屏蔽微信右上角的举报按钮,直接让用户无法举报,直接屏蔽了微信的举报功能,效果很不错。 微信技术在不断升级更新,以后有机会把防屏蔽机制和经验总结给大家交流。

5. 域名防火墙

通过技术手段给推广域名加防火墙进行解析,解析后在微信内推广,检测系统是无法抓取到的,从而实现微信内域名防封防拦截。

该技术也是目前比较先进的防封技术,相比较各大平台使用的那套老技术,优势可以说是非常大,防封稳定效果好。

此处顺便给大家科普一下,域名防封技术只能延长域名的寿命,是无法做到不死域名的。各大平台所说的百分百防封,那都是扯淡,希望大家不要被忽悠了。

 

微信域名防封跳转技术原理,微信域名防封的细节把控

标签:切换   img   size   api   错误页面   安防   直接   源码解析   int   

原文地址:https://www.cnblogs.com/xxdg/p/10456056.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!